> Why enum?
> Maybe use a regular class with a public constructor should do it.
> What do you think?
The idea is to make it easy and obvious to use from preview code:
PreviewFeature.MY_PREVIEW_FEATURE.checkEnabled();
In addition to that, any IDE can easily list all uses of an enum constant, which gives you an overview where APIs of a particular feature are located. After all, enums are just regular classes with singleton instances.
By the way, preview features can't be individually enabled or disabled. The point of checking on a enum constant is to generate an appropriate error message (including the name of the feature) in case the user didn't enable preview features.
